Abstract
Micropollutants are water pollutants with the maximum concentrations as high as few micro- grams/liter and the minimum concentrations as low as few nanograms/liter of water. Micro- pollutants typically enter water streams as a result of human activity. Advanced oxidation processes are water puri- fication technologies which involve generation of strong oxidizing species that destroy pollutants. Photocatalysis is light-activated acceleration of chemical reactions in the presence of a light- absorbing photocatalyst material. Heterogeneous photocatalysis uses a light- absorbing solid photocatalyst to produce oxidiz- ing and reducing species in the presence of light. Heterogeneous photocatalysis is one of the advanced oxidation technologies for water treat- ment, which uses strong oxidizing species to degrade organic pollutants.
